MLB 10: RTTS 2014 Recap / 2015 Spring Training 
Posted on April 17, 2010 at 03:14 PM.
Well, 2014 has finished with my Texas Rangers coming up short in their bid to win the AL Wild Card. We started September 10 or 11 games out of the wild card behind Boston, Oakland, and one other team I'm forgetting right now. September was arguably our best month as we ate up ground, but ultimately we came up short and watched from the sidelines as the Yankees won another ring.

I came back from injury in late June/early July and was inexplicably used off the bench for about 2 months, despite repeated appeals to my manager to put me back in the lineup (the 4-year contract I signed at the beginning of the season has me as an MLB starter). He kept denying me due to Hamilton's hot streak, which was absolutely non-existent. For proof, here's a screenshot of the Who's Hot / Who's Not slide before a game I actually got to start in, right after the manager bit my head off for asking him to put me in the starting lineup: http://picasaweb.google.com/lh/photo...eat=directlink

Consequently, combined with the trip to the 60-day DL in late April, I only got 232 plate appearances, in which I had 83 hits, 11HR and 31RBI, for a .358 average. It took me until late August before I completed a series of goals and was reinstated as a starter. In my first three MLB seasons, I'm averaging 261AB's, resulting in an average of 100 hits, 13HR and 42RBI, with a career batting average of .384.

We have just completed the 2015 spring training. This spring, I finished with a .435BA, with 37 hits in 85 plate appearances, 3HRs and 15RBI, to go along with 23 runs. Hopefully I can carry this over to the regular season and hopefully I can stay healthy throughout this entire season.

Career MLB stats through 3 season: 783AB, .384AVG, 301 hits, 118 runs, 54 doubles, 4 triples, 40HR and 125RBi.
